Cultural Representations in Modern Media
Popular culture, particularly television shows and movies, has significantly popularized the concept of anti-possession supernatural tattoos. Shows like Supernatural have brought this mystical protection method into mainstream consciousness, inspiring fans and enthusiasts to explore its deeper meanings.

Are anti-possession tattoos real?
+While rooted in mythology and folklore, anti-possession tattoos are primarily symbolic representations of spiritual protection rather than guaranteed supernatural shields.
Where did anti-possession tattoos originate?
+The concept draws from various cultural traditions, including ancient protective symbolism, mystical practices, and modern interpretations of spiritual defense.
Can anyone get an anti-possession tattoo?
+Yes, anyone interested in the symbolic meaning can get such a tattoo. However, it's important to understand its cultural and spiritual significance before getting inked.
